Engineering Design of a Mechanical Decladder for Spent Nuclear Rod-Cuts
Table 3
Design requirements of mechanical decladder.
| Contents | Design requirements | Remarks |
| Capacities | (i) 4 m fuel rod/4 min (1 rod-cut/30 s) (ii) Process time of PWR 16 × 16 assembly: 15 h × 2 units (iii) Rod-cut: 500 mm length | PWR (pressurized water reactor) | Extrusion method | (i) Cylinder drive: hydraulics (ii) Cylinder quantity: double acting × 2 units | AC 220 V, 3 P | Blade | (i) Blade material: high-speed steel (ii) Blade module quantity: 4 modules (iii) Blade type: 3-CUT blade modules | | Feeding and recovery | (i) Horizontal type (ii) Rod-cut feeding: rack and pinion, autofeeding (iii) Separation of hulls and fragments | 37.5 kg HM-U/batch: 1 unit |
